World film premiere of '20th Century Boys' held in Paris

PARIS —

The world premiere of the new film “20th Century Boys” was on held in Paris on Wednesday.

Actor Toshiaki Karasawa, 45, and actress Takako Tokiwa, 36, were present to introduce the film which is scheduled to be released in 20 countries this year.

The film is based on a popular comic “20th Century Boys” in which children try to predict what might happen in the future.

Tokiwa told attendees of the premiere, “We all love the original comics. So much so that our producers were willing to make this film even without being paid.”

The film consists of three episodes, and the first episode will be released in Japan on August 30, France in Nov or Dec, followed by other countries later.
